采煤机摇臂行星轮齿根应力分析  被引量:2

Analysis of Root Stress of Planetary Wheel of Rocking Arm of Shearer Loader

摘  要:根据采煤机摇臂行星结构的特点,对采煤机摇臂行星轮的齿根应力进行了分析,得到了齿根应力复合函数。通过研究齿根应力与过盈量、滚动轴承外圈内孔半径之间的关系,得到了减小采煤机摇臂行星轮齿根应力的方法,并通过有限元仿真进行了验证。According to the characteristics of the planetary structure of the rocking arm of the shearer loader, the root stress of the planetary wheel of the rocking arm of the shearer loader was analyzed to obtain the compound function of root stress. By studying the relationship between the root stress and the interference and the inner radius of the outer ring of the rolling bearing, the method to reduce the root stress of the planetary wheel of the rocking arm in the shearer has been obtained and verified by the finite element simulation.
